AXIA Energia Approves R$800M Debenture Issuance

AI Summary

AXIA Energia S.A. announced that its Board of Directors approved the 9th issuance of simple, non-convertible debentures. The aggregate principal amount is R$800 million, with an overallotment option that could increase the total transaction volume to R$1 billion. These unsecured debentures have a 10-year maturity, with amortization beginning in the eighth year, and are targeted exclusively at professional investors.

Key Highlights

  • Board approved 9th issuance of simple, non-convertible debentures.
  • Aggregate principal amount of R$800 million.
  • Overallotment option of up to 25%, totaling up to R$1 billion.
  • Debentures are unsecured with semi-annual interest payments.
  • Amortization in annual payments starting June 15, 2034.
  • Maturity date is June 15, 2036 (10-year term).
  • Yield capped at greater of NTN-B 2035 or IPCA + 7.66% p.a.
  • Offering targets professional investors and benefits from tax incentives.
